Definition
- 1Schusswaffe, die mit Schießpulver oder ähnlichen Treibmitteln betrieben wird
Recorded use
Wiktionary examplesThese source excerpts show how Feuerwaffe appears in context. They illustrate usage; the definition above remains the entry’s reference meaning.
In Wildwestfilmen spielen Feuerwaffen immer eine große Rolle.
„Vielleicht hatten sich die feindlichen Heere fürs Erste mit genügend Gewehren, Kugeln und Schießpulver eingedeckt, vielleicht war aber auch Agaja schon zu sehr in die Defensive gedrängt, um sein Heer weiter mit Feuerwaffen versorgen zu können.“
